The Himmelfahrtstagung on Bioprocess Engineering is an annual conference bringing together experts in this field to discuss the latest developments and innovations.
The meeting covers a wide range of topics related to bioprocess engineering, including novel bioprocesses, smart technologies and their combination in upstream and downstream processing, and bioprocess solutions to achieve sustainable development goals.
The conference is a great opportunity to gain access to the scientific knowledge, technologies and contacts needed to improve efficiencies in all phases of bioproduct development and manufacturing, from basic chemicals to biopharmaceuticals.
Major Topics will be:
Recent Advances in
- Upstream bioprocess development for current biopharmaceuticals
- Producing next generation of biopharmaceuticals
- Developing sustainable production processes for industrial bioeconomy
- Intensifying bioprocesses with innovative means
- Efficiently linking downstream with upstream bioprocesses
- Data science & AI for strain and bioprocess development
- Open Topic
Noteworthy, the ‘Himmelfahrtstagung’ also serves as a platform for young scientists to present their results to the scientific community. As such, young researches are invited to submit their work to the committee for getting the chance of presentation, irrespective of the topic of the conference.

We´d like to invite you to our workshop "Novel Tools for Process Optimization". In this workshop we will focus on the importance of data and how it can be used for process optimization. We will discuss the benefits of off-gas parameters such as OUR, CER and RQ and demonstrate their application in practice.
In addition, we will present unconventional application examples, including the use of relative and absolute humidity. Finally, we will introduce you to BlueVIS, a software with almost unlimited possibilities to help you make your processes more efficient. The official language of the conference is English. Simultaneous translation will be not available.
A brief CV questionary enables the appropriate chair person to introduce all lecturers to the audience. Therefore lecturers are asked to download the CV form and to return it to the conference office until 22 April 2024.
The ideal format for the presentation is 16:9. A notebook (MS Office 2010, Adobe Acrobat Reader 9.3) and a wireless spotlight presenter will be provided. Please bring your presentation slides as PowerPoint or PDF-File on a USB stick. Nevertheless we kindly ask you to bring your own laptop computer as a backup.
In case that you need internet /special software for your presentation or if you have videos included into your file, please notify the conference secretariat in advance.
The abstract (incl. figures) should be typed single-spaced (12 pt Arial font, 2.5 cm margins, page size DIN A4) and should include the title, authors, their affiliations plus city and country.
Please upload your abstract as PDF file.
Keynote lecture: | 40 minutes plus 5 minutes time for discussion |
---|---|
Oral presentation: | 20 minutes plus 10 minutes time for discussion |
Short lecture: | 15 minutes plus 5 minutes time for discussion (Open topic) |
Strict timekeeping will be essential for the smooth running of the conference. We suggest to use a minimum font size of 24 pt for your presentation slides.
As a major guideline it is proposed to make the poster intelligible in itself, even in the absence of the author. It is suggested to divide the content of each poster into introduction, results and conclusion, with a summary listing the pertinent results and conclusion.
The poster should be legible from a distance of 2-3 meters. Standard size for posters is 0.85 x 1.2 m (DIN A0 German Standard) vertically oriented. Therefore, please find the following specifications:
